Understanding Uranium Exports
First, let’s get a handle on what uranium exports entail. Uranium, in its raw form, is a naturally occurring radioactive element. It becomes incredibly valuable once it's processed and enriched, primarily for use in nuclear power plants to generate electricity. It's also used in medical treatments, industrial applications, and, controversially, in the production of nuclear weapons. Because of its dual-use nature, the export and import of uranium are heavily regulated internationally.
Countries that export uranium typically have significant uranium deposits and the infrastructure to mine and process it. These exports are subject to strict international safeguards to ensure they are used for peaceful purposes. The International Atomic Energy Agency (IAEA) plays a crucial role in monitoring these movements and ensuring compliance with non-proliferation treaties. So, when we talk about Iprusia Sestopse exporting uranium, we're not just talking about digging up rocks; we're talking about a carefully orchestrated process with global implications.
The key players in the uranium export market are countries like Kazakhstan, Canada, Australia, and Namibia. These nations hold vast reserves and have established reliable export mechanisms. Case Studies and Examples
To illustrate the complexities of uranium exports, let's look at some real-world examples. Consider Kazakhstan, the world's leading uranium producer. Kazakhstan has developed a robust export infrastructure and works closely with the IAEA to ensure compliance with international standards. Its success can provide valuable lessons for other countries looking to enter the uranium market.
Another example is Australia, which has the world's largest uranium reserves. Australia has a strict regulatory framework for uranium mining and export, emphasizing environmental protection and non-proliferation. Its approach can serve as a model for responsible uranium management.
